You don’t need to replace the system version. But ok, let’s keep Qt 5.12 as the minimum version for Qt Creator 4.13. We’ve got lots of changes that can also be done with Qt 5.12. For Qt Creator 4.14 it will become either Qt 5.14 or Qt 5.15, depending on need.
